Find the amount to which 800 will grow under each of these conditions8% compounded semiannually for 10 years. Do not round intermediate calculations. Round your answer to the nearest cent.

Solution steps
Translate the problem into an equation:A=800(1+20.08​)2⋅10
800(1+20.08​)2⋅10=1752.89851…
Round to the nearest hundredth:1752.9
Amount:1752.9
